I happened to find these at Treasure Island in Vegas just now. I messaged some friends, and they recommended an active wild on a timer in the first three reels. If you found two in reels four and five, that would be good enough too. It’s preferred when they are in the center of the screen rather than at the top or bottom (like a Star Goddess type of thing).
It’s a quick-hitting type of game (just a few spins usually). I attached a photo of something I’d play. I’ll add this to the list and will get a full write-up next week.

To more generally try to answer, the “best cruise” is ever-changing. The best cruise is the one with the most advantage play games and the least competition. It’s hard to account for the latter—though I speculated a bit on that in the third link—but there are ways to factor in the former.
My number one piece of advice would be to check YouTube for current videos of the slot room floor for whatever cruise you’re thinking about. Say it’s Norwegian Joy you’re thinking about. You’d type in “Norwegian Joy slot tour videos 2026,” and different versions of that, until you found enough footage. Even “short videos” on Google can be useful.
Once you’ve identified a ship with a number of advantage play games, hope for the best. If it’s you and 10 other people checking games in a small casino—the most I’ve experienced is four others—it’s going to be a rough situation. If you’re the only one, it’ll be hard to have a bad experience.

In the write-up to this game, you say Golden Gecko is nine years old. I’d then guess that Golden Gecko is on the “Own” side of the Rent/Own inventory in casinos where it’s still offered. (If any Geckos are still being rented after nine years, they’ve been paid for at least a dozen times over by now.)
As I mentioned in another post, Rent-vs-Own is not something I give a lot of thought to, but I am aware of it, and the point I’m trying to make is that games owned by a casino can have a long shelf life. And if you do happen to come across a play on an owned game, that game could be your fishing hole for a good long time – like maybe nine years or more.
